4.3.7.3 Dirac Optimization
The Dirac Live setup procedure must be used to copy Dirac configuration setup files to the
AP20 before this screen becomes functional. Ignore this screen if you are not using Dirac
Live software to setup the AP20.
Menu (System) > Formats > Audio EQ Setup > Dirac Optimization
Figure 50. Dirac Optimization Screen
Dirac Room Optimization Enabled/Disabled – Touching the button will toggle between
enabling and disabling the Dirac Optimization.
Current Dirac Configuration – Displays the name of the current Dirac configuration.
Select – Select a configuration from the list of saved configurations in the box above, then
touch the Select button. This configuration will now become the current Dirac configuration.
Delete – Select a configuration from the list of saved configurations in the box above, then
touch the Delete button. The configuration will be deleted from the list and from the memory
of the AP20.
